Cython Bindings#
The Cython language is a superset of the Python language that additionally supports calling C functions and declaring C types on variables and class attributes.

Pybind11 Bindings#
pybind11 is a lightweight header-only library that exposes C++ types in Python and vice versa, mainly to create Python bindings of existing C++ code.

NumPy C-API Headers#
NumPy provides a C-API to enable users to extend the system and get access to the array object for use in other routines. The best way to truly understand …
See also
import numpy as np
# Return the directory that contains the NumPy *.h header files.
np.get_include()
